JUST IN: Two men hospitalised after falling four metres onto concrete bricks

Both men were treated on scene.

Two men have been transported to hospital after falling four metres onto concrete bricks in Bedfordview this afternoon.

The incident took place at a construction site along Kloof Road.

According to Mr Russel Meiring, spokesperson for ER24, one of the men was seriously injured while the other sustained moderate injuries.

“ER24 paramedics arrived on the scene and found that both men had already been removed from the initial scene and were being attended to by their colleagues. On assessment, paramedics found that one had sustained numerous, serious injuries while the other man had sustained only moderate injuries,” said Mr Meiring.

He said both men were treated on scene.

“The seriously injured man was provided with advanced life support intervention. Once treated, both patients were transported to a nearby private hospital for further treatment,” said Mr Meiring.

He said the cause of the accident will be investigated.
